Canara Bank 3-Year FCF Growth Rate Calculation

This is the 3-year average growth rate of Free Cash Flow per Share. The growth rate is calculated using exponential compounding based on the latest four year annual data.

Canara Bank  (BOM:532483) 3-Year FCF Growth Rate Explanation

Free Cash Flow per Share is the amount of Free Cash Flow per outstanding share of the company's stock. Free Cash Flow is considered one of the most important parameters to measure a company's earnings power by value investors because it is not subject to estimates of Depreciation, Depletion and Amortization (DDA). However, when we look at the Free Cash Flow, we should look from a long term perspective, because any year's Free Cash Flow can be drastically affected by the spending on Property, Plant, & Equipment (PPE) of the business in that year. Over the long term, Free Cash Flow should give pretty good picture on the real earnings power of the company. It's used in the calculation of Forward Rate of Return (Yacktman) %.

Canara Bank is an India-based commercial bank. The company's core businesses consist of Treasury Operations, Retail Banking Operations, and Corporate and Wholesale Banking Operations. It conducts a broad range of banking activities serving large and midsize corporations. Its priority sector and retail sector lending business offer funding services to the priority and retail sectors, such as loans to agriculture, housing, and educational institutions. The company owns a large branch network across India, with several branches in overseas cities such as New York, London, Hong Kong, and Dubai.
